[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Re: SVN-Server aufsetzten



On Sat, 5 May 2007, Patrick Cornelißen wrote:

Einfach den inetd eintrag aus der doku reinkopieren in die config und
inetd neu starten

Das habe ich mal gemacht, weil es mir am sinnvollsten erschien.
Trotzdem scheine ich nicht der erste zu sein, der eine den
üblichen Debian-Gepflogenheiten entsprechende Hilfe per vorbereitetem
Init-Skript mit einem /etc/default/script, das regelt, per welcher
Methode der Server denn un gestartet werden soll.  Der Bug #232584
ist mittlerweile schon über drei Jahre alt und so richtig klar ist
mir nicht, warum der nicht mal wenigstens ansatzweise per Dokumentation
z.B. in einem README.Debian geschlossen wird.

Wie dem auch sei, so richtig funktioniert es immer noch nicht, denn
nach einem

cat >> /etc/inetd.conf <<EOF
svn stream tcp nowait svn /usr/bin/svnserve svnserve -i
EOF

geht es auch noch nicht mal vom localhost:

   $svn co svn://localhost/<myrepository>
   svn: Netzwerkverbindung wurde unerwartet geschlossen

Im Syslog steht dann

May  7 13:44:43 wrvm01 inetd[7471]: getpwnam: svn: No such user

woraus ich zunächst erstmal schließe, daß svnserve tatsächlich etwas
getan hat.  Ich frage mich nur, warum jetzt noch ein spezieller
Nutzer gebraucht wird, denn in

      <myrepository>/conf/svnserve.conf

habe ich erstmal nichts verändert und es steht dort drin:

### These options control access to the repository for unauthenticated ### and authenticated users. Valid values are "write", "read", ### and "none". The sample settings below are the defaults. # anon-access = read # auth-access = write

das heißt, ich sollte doch erstmal annonym lesen können, oder?

Viele Grüße

         Andreas.

--
http://fam-tille.de

Reply to: